How they compare

Oman currently reports 0.9% against 0.8% in Gibraltar, a difference of 0.1%.

The two have swapped places 2 times across 74 shared years of data; in 1950 it was Oman ahead.

Gibraltar ranks 145th and Oman ranks 142nd of 236 countries.

Oman has averaged higher in every one of the 8 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Gibraltar Oman Difference Ahead
1950s 4.1% 22.0% 17.9% Oman
1960s 2.9% 18.0% 15.1% Oman
1970s 2.4% 11.7% 9.3% Oman
1980s 1.9% 5.5% 3.6% Oman
1990s 1.4% 2.2% 0.8% Oman
2000s 1.1% 1.1% 0.0% Oman
2010s 0.9% 0.9% 0.0% Oman
2020s 0.8% 0.9% 0.0% Oman

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
